
Sahibzada Farhan smashed his first worldwide T20 century and Usman Tariq confused Namibia together with his thriller spin as Pakistan secured a Tremendous 8s spot on the T20 World Cup with a 102-run win on Wednesday.
Opening batter Farhan smashed an unbeaten 100 off 58 balls, that includes 4 sixes and 11 boundaries, whereas futher contributions from captain Salman Ali Agha (38) and Shadab Khan (36 not out) carried Pakistan to 199-3 within the Group A sport in Colombo.
Tariq, who has a particular pause-and-bowl motion, then grabbed 4-16 and Shadab took 3-19 as Namibia had been dismissed for 97 in 17.3 overs, for his or her fourth-straight loss within the event.
